SANFORD — Bonnie Lee Angers, 51, of Sanford, died Sunday, June 1, 2014, after a long battle with cancer, with her children by her side.
She was born to Leon and Joan Angers, April 14, 1963 in Rochester, N.H.
Bonnie was best known as a mother and a friend. She was an amazing person, a giver and a fighter. She always made sure to have a smile on her face.
Bonnie is survived by: four children, Justin Angers, Kelley Boulard, Tasha Boulard and Samantha Anne Hans; and two grandchildren, with another on the way.
A graveside service will be held at 10 a.m. on Tuesday, June 10 at Oakdale Cemetery, located on Twombley Road in Sanford.
